反应信息

  • 作为反应物:
    描述:
    dimethyl 3,3'-[butane-1,4-diylbis(oxy)]bis(2-naphthalenecarboxylate) 在 lithium aluminium tetrahydride 作用下, 以 四氢呋喃 为溶剂, 反应 0.5h, 以75%的产率得到3,3'-[butane-1,4-diylbis(oxy)]bis(2-naphthalenemethanol)
    参考文献:
    名称:
    Naphthaldehyde-derived ligands: synthesis and their Ni(II) ion complexation
    摘要:
    Three novel diazacrown ether ligands, namely 17-, 18-, and 20-membered O2N2-donor macrocycles derived from 3,3'-[butane-1,4-diylbis(oxy)]bis(2-naphthalenecarbaldehyde), were prepared and characterized by H-1 and C-13 NMR spectroscopy and mass spectra. Their host-guest interaction with Ni(II) was studied in DMSO-d (6) using H-1 NMR spectroscopy. The stoichiometry of the complex in each case in the concentration range examined was determined to be 1:1 using the continuous variation method (Job's plot). The 17-membered O2N2-donor macrocycle in which the two nitrogen atoms are tethered by three methylene units binds Ni(II) more strongly than the other two macrocycles do.
    DOI:
    10.1007/s00706-013-1079-3
